My Stats Say I’m On An Upswing
In the last four days, my Views and Reads are developing exceptionally well. But it remains to be seen whether this is an outlier or a trend.
Having earned over $100 on Medium in March and April, I was not sure if I could repeat this success in the first half of May.
In the first half of the month, from 01 to May 15th, I had earned 42.50 dollars. When I extrapolated the daily average of $2.83 to 31 days, I came up with estimated earnings of $87.73 for May.
This frustrated me a little because, since the beginning of March, I have been writing daily on Medium. In mid-March, I started writing for the new publication Illumination, and my statistics jumped up significantly.
I attribute my first month of over $100 directly to Illumination.
When I was able to repeat the excellent result in April, I was sure that I would break the $100 mark in May as well.
But then, on May 16th, I sat in front of my Excel spreadsheet and was at a loss. I had worked just as hard as in the previous two months, but my earnings were falling. On one day, May 7th, I only earned 87 cents. That was an absolute low point. How could that be?
But the very next day, the medium gods decided to give me new hope again. The day I had looked back so depressed at the first half of the month turned out to be the most auspicious day I had ever had on Medium.
I had earned $6.63 in a single day. Of course, this is ridiculously low compared to the earnings of those who can finance their lives with their Medium income, but for me, it was a significant milestone.
Fast forward to today. Today is May 24th. So I only know the results of eight days of the second half of the month. But in those eight days, I have already earned $47.70.
That is $5.20 more than in the whole first half of the month.
If I extrapolate the daily average to the month at the moment, I come to an expected result of 121.57 dollars. So May could be my most successful month on Medium.

But I am cautious and do not expect this result too strongly. First of all, I am not a data scientist and can be entirely wrong when it comes to identifying something as a trend. Secondly, I am aware that Medium is unpredictable.
The last four days in particular, at $7.23, $6.36, $6.14 and $8.58, were the strongest four days I’ve ever had in a row, but that doesn’t say anything about the next few days.
So my stats seem to say I’m on an upswing, but time has to show if this is really the case.
Nevertheless, this development motivates me enormously. It really seems that hard work and continuity can pay off on this platform.
At the end of the month, I will take a closer look here. Then you can find out whether I was happy too early or whether the trend is really a good one.
